First Time Setup
This section explains the settings that you need to make before using the AV receiver for the very first time.
If the impedance of any speaker is 4 ohms or more but
less than 6, set the Speaker Impedance to 4 ohms.
If you’ve connected your front speakers to the FRONT
and SURR BACK terminal posts for bi-amping or
bridging (TX-SR875 only), you must change the
Speaker Type setting. For hookup information, see “Bi-
amping the Front Speakers” on page 23, or “Bridging the
Front Speakers (TX-SR875 only)” on page 24.
Notes:
When bridging is used, the AV receiver is able to drive
up to 2.1 speakers in the main room.
When bi-amping is used, the AV receiver is able to
drive up to 5.1 speakers in the main room.
Before you change these settings, turn down the vol-
ume.
Notes:
This procedure can also be performed on the AV
receiver by using its [SETUP], [ENTER], and arrow
buttons.
The design of the TX-SR805 and TX-SR875 onscreen
setup menus is slightly different. The TX-SR805
onscreen setup menus are used throughout this
instruction manual.
Speaker Settings
1
Press the [RECEIVER] button,
followed by the [SETUP] button.
The main menu appears onscreen.
2
Use the Up and Down [ ]/[ ]
buttons to select “2. Speaker
Setup, and then press [ENTER].
The Speaker Setup menu appears.

If you change these settings, you must run the auto-
matic speaker setup again (see page 55).
RECEIVER
S
E
T
U
P
ENTER
ENTER
3
Use the Up and Down [ ]/[ ]
buttons to select “1. Speaker Set-
tings, and then press [ENTER].
The Speaker Settings menu appears.
4
Use the Up and Down [ ]/[ ]
buttons to select “Speaker
Impedance, and use the Left and
Right [ ]/[ ] buttons to select:
4 ohms:
Select if the impedance of any
speaker is 4 ohms or more but
less than 6.
6 ohms:
Select if the impedances of all
speakers are between 6 and
16 ohms.
5
Use the Up and Down [ ]/[ ]
buttons to select “Speaker Type,
and use the Left and Right
[ ]/[ ] buttons to select:
Normal:
Select this if you’ve con-
nected your front speakers
normally.
Bi-Amp:
Select this if you’ve con-
nected your front speakers for
bi-amped operation.
BTL:
(TX-SR875 only) Select this
if you’ve connected your
front speakers for bridged
operation. The BTL indicator
will appear on the display.
6
Press the [SETUP] button.
Setup closes.
